This Contempt Petition is filed alleging breach of order GANESH SUBHASH LOKHANDE of this Court dated 10th February 2017 in Writ Petition No. 4520 of 2016. The Writ Petition was filed by the Management challenging the judgment and order dated 8th March 2016 passed by the School Tribunal. The School Tribunal, while setting aside the termination order dated 30th April 2013, has directed Petitioner's reinstatement with 50% back-wages.
2.
The learned counsel for the Petitioner would submit that the Petitioner has been reinstated in service. It appears that during pendency of Writ Petition No. 4520 of 2016, the amount towards 50% of back-wages were also deposited in this Court. The
Ganesh Lokhande 2/2 64-CP-448-2018.doc grievance of Petitioner now is that despite reinstatement, he is not being paid salary. This grievance of the Petitioner would not be covered by the order dated 8th March 2016 passed by the School Tribunal. In that view of the matter, it cannot be stated that breach of order dated 10th February 2017 passed by this Court has been committed by the Respondent-Management.
3.
The Contempt Petition is accordingly closed.
4.
The Petitioner would be at liberty to file appropriate proceedings in respect of his grievance about nonpayment of salary. SANDEEP V. MARNE, J.
